Six Great Fishing Spots Near Dahlonega, GA

Fishing is a hobby and sport that's not just relaxing: it can be fun. This town is nestled into the Blue Ridge Mountains and offers a variety of excellent areas to fish. Next time you're heading out for a day of fishing, here are some great fishing spots near Dahlonega, Georgia. 1: Lake Zwerner Lake Zwerner is only a short drive from the downtown area. This lake provides most of the city with its water supply, but you're allowed to fish in the lake too. The main types of fish that you can catch in this lake include Bream and Bass. more 2: Waters Creek Approximately 10 miles from town is Waters Creek. This stream is a popular spot for catching different species of trout. The types of trout that have been caught here previously include rainbow trout, brown trout, and brook trout. You're only allowed to fish here with a hook that is a size six or smaller and with an artificial lure. There are a few fishing permits and stamps you need to fish here, so be sure to check the website for requirements. 3: Frog Hollow Fly Fishing If you're looking for an exciting fishing experience, Frog Hollow Fly Fishing might be an option for you. The owner of the company owns a private area of the river that he will take anglers fly fishing on. You cannot fish any other way besides fly fishing here, and it's a catch and release tour. The owner books tours for fly fishing, bass, and trout. You can check out their website for the rates for fishing in their private river. 4: Etowah River You can only go fishing in the Etowah River during the fishing season. The fishing season in Georgia is from March 1st until July 15th, statewide. The best part to fish the Etowah river is in the Wildlife Management Area. There's a lot of fish that you can catch here. A few species that swim in the river are carp, blue and channel catfish, striped bass, redbreast sunfish, and redeye and spotted bass. 5: Lake Winfield Scott The fish at Lake Winfield Scott are regularly stocked during trout season. There is a fishing pier located on the lake that allowed anglers a fantastic spot to fish. You can expect to catch trout, catfish, bass, brim, and perch in this lake. 6: Jones Creek If you're searching for the best place in the area to catch brown trout, you need to try fishing in Jones Creek. This creek is not a stocked body of water and contains almost exclusively brown trout. Unlike some other fishing areas, Jones Creek is only open for fishing during the fishing season. 6 Standout Features of the 2022 Ford Explorer

When you need to escape from traffic, leave the pavement, and carve a path through rugged terrains, no other SUV is more appropriate for the job than the legendary Ford Explorer. The 2022 edition comes with an impressive array of powerful performance options, including a 400-horsepower V6 engine, as well as advanced technology adorned throughout its luxurious interior. Among its many exceptional features, here are six standouts that help separate the 2022 Ford Explorer from other SUVs. 1. Surface-Sensing 4WD The available Intelligent 4WD System takes cues from the vehicle and your actions to know when the four-wheel-drive should automatically be engaged. The vehicle's wheel speed, steering wheel angle, and the position of the accelerator pedal can all help the system decide when more torque is needed for different terrains. more 2. Dynamic Terrain Modes While the vehicle's available four-wheel-drive system adjusts to different surfaces automatically, it's complemented by a terrain management system that gives you full control over its multiple driving modes. With the push of a button, you can bring the vehicle out of normal mode while choosing whether the vehicle should be saving fuel in Eco mode, optimized for agility in Sport, ready for rain with Slippery, or with traction optimized to tackle snow or sand. 3. A Co-Pilot for Parking With the Reverse Brake Assist option combined with the standard Rearview Camera feature, reversing into parking spaces is easier than ever before. While the rearview camera sends a digital image to the display screen within the vehicle, you'll also receive alert warnings from the brake assist system in case you don't see something or have the camera turned off. 4. Puncture-Aversive Tires Opting for the Michelin self-sealing tires can help prevent random tire punctures from ruining your day. When a nail or other object punctures one of these durable tires, a sealant is automatically dispersed to the location where the air leak has occurred. This can reduce roadside stops so you can continue your journey safely until you're able to have it properly inspected by a technician. 5. 12-Speaker Audio System If music is your passion, the B&O luxury sound system, with its 12 dynamic speakers, will blow you away. Standard for the Limited, ST, and Platinum trims, this audio system is designed to reduce sound distortion, so even songs you've been familiar with your whole life will sound as if they've been remastered with greater clarity. 6. Power Massaging Seats What's better than power-operated seats that you can freely move around for more legroom? How about multi-contour seats with Active Motion in the front row that provide back massages for both your upper and lower back? In addition to giving back massages, these relaxing seats also include a seat cushion massage function, which can help to improve blood circulation to your legs while on long trips. The 2022 Explorer's adaptive nature when tackling different terrains is reflected throughout its performance and driver-assist features, while its tech options and safety monitoring systems are all years ahead of the competition's. Fitness in Dahlonega: 4 Great Ways to Stay in Shape

If you're looking for ways to stay in shape, Dahlonega, GA, is a great place to be. With its beautiful scenery and abundance of outdoor activities, you'll never get bored with your fitness routine. Here are four fun and effective ways to get fit in Dahlonega. Join a Gym Consider joining a gym like the DFC. Located on East Main Street, this fantastic gym is an excellent place to get a good workout. With its wide variety of equipment and classes, you're sure to find something that you enjoy. And if you need some motivation, the friendly staff is always happy to help. more The center has workout plans that help you achieve your goals. You can partner with one of their trainers to create a custom plan or follow one of their group classes. They also offer personal training sessions so that you can get the most out of your workout. Take a Hike With its many hiking trails, Dahlonega is a great place to get some fresh air and exercise, and there's no better way to experience the area's beauty than by hiking its trails. From easy strolls to strenuous climbs, there's a trail for every skill level. If you're new to hiking, we recommend starting with one of the easier trails, such as the DeSoto Falls Trail. The trail has easy-to-follow signage and incredible views with five waterfalls along the way. For a more challenging workout, try the Amicalola Falls trail. This trail is relatively short but more strenuous because you'll hike to the top of the tallest waterfall in Georgia! Go Mountain Biking Dahlonega also has excellent biking trails that are perfect for a morning or afternoon ride. The Jake and Bull Mountain Trail System is a 36-mile system of interconnected trails that wind through western Lumpkin County. These scenic trails are primarily dirt and gravel and used by both walkers and horseback riders. If you're looking for a challenging ride, try the Bull Mountain Trail. This 9.5-mile trail climbs to the top of Bull Mountain and offers beautiful views. This trail is rated moderate to hard due to sections with steep climbs and fast descents. The Bare Hare trail at the top of the Bull Mountain loop has the highest elevation of any trail in the area. Try Crossfit Crossfit is a great way to get a full-body workout. With its high-intensity interval training, you'll burn calories and build muscle. The best part of Crossfit is that you can do it at your own pace with the movements that work best for you. Gold City CrossFit on Deer Run Drive offers group classes perfect for beginners. Gold City offers small classes led by experienced instructors who will help you get the most out of your workout. It's a friendly environment with a thriving community that's more like family. So whether you're looking for an intense workout or just want to relax and have some fun, Dahlonega has many ways to maintain a healthy lifestyle. Is It Time to Replace Your Car Air Filter?

You might not be aware of it, but your car's air filter can become clogged and dirty, leading to a variety of problems with your vehicle. It may use more gas than it used to, or you may start hearing strange noises when the engine is running that weren't there before. You may need a new car air filter from your Ford dealer if any of these six signs are true for you and your vehicle. 1. Your Car Is Using More Gas Than It Used To When the air filter is clogged and dirty, it can't let as much air into the engine. This causes the engine to work harder to get enough air to the combustion chamber, which uses more gas. If your car is getting fewer miles per gallon, that could be a sign that you need a new air filter. more 2. You Hear Strange Noises If you hear strange noises, that could be a sign that you need a new air filter. When the air filter is clogged and dirty, it can't let as much air into the engine. This causes the engine to work harder to get enough air, which uses more gas. 3. The Check Engine Light Has Come On If the check engine light has come on in your car, that's another sign that you may need a new air filter. The check engine light usually comes on when there's something wrong with one of the car's systems. And one of the things it could mean is that there's not enough air getting into the engine because of a dirty or clogged air filter. 4. Your Car Is Harder to Start If your vehicle is harder to start up, that could mean the air filter needs to be replaced. When the air filter is clogged and dirty, it can't let as much air into the engine. This causes the engine to work harder, which uses up more gas. 5. The Air Filter Is Visibly Dirty Car filters are generally white or off-white, so they should be replaced if the filter is visibly dirty. If you stick to the recommended maintenance schedule for your car, the filter will be replaced regularly. Still, it's also a good idea to open the hood and periodically check its condition. Your owner's manual has more information about your air filter and a recommended maintenance schedule. 6. Your Car Has Less Power Than Normal Air filters help your engine run more efficiently. If you have less power than usual, a faulty air filter may be the cause. Air filters can gather dirt and debris, but they can also collapse or become damaged, reducing their effectiveness. 4 of the Best Museums to Visit Near Dahlonega, GA

Looking to get out and learn about the Dahlonega, GA area's history? There are lots of great things to do. Make sure you visit the 4 best museums in the area. 1. Dahlonega Gold Museum Located in one of Georgia's oldest courthouse buildings still standing, the Dahlonega Gold Museum is a great place to visit if you're looking to learn a little more about the area's history of gold. Even before California's Gold Rush, the Dahlonega area was rich with gold and prospectors were no strangers to its riches. When you visit this museum, you'll get to see a range of artifacts from this area. You'll also be able to learn more about the building's interesting history as a courthouse. Check out the judge's chambers, and remember to visit the gift shop for a souvenir too. more 2. Folk Pottery Museum of Northeast Georgia If you're in the Dahlonega area and you're not afraid of a bit of a drive, then this museum is one that you're going to want to visit. Offering you plenty of lessons in pottery and the area's art history, you're going to love checking out the Folk Pottery Museum of Northeast Georgia. You'll get to see the work of some of the area's local artists, and the museum offers an interactive experience. There's also a playground for children to visit, and a large campus to walk around and explore. 3. The 1875 Chestatee River Diving Bell Early American diving technology might not be something that many people think about. But Lumpkin County locals know a thing or two about how strange and unique this old technology is. You can visit the 1875 Chestatee River Diving Bell to learn a little more about the area's history of diving. This outdoor exhibition offers visitors factual documentation on how diving would have worked during this era. Make sure that you visit the bell to learn about how it would have worked and the ways that its presence has affected the area. 4. Northeast Georgia History Center Looking to learn a little more about the Georgia area's history? If you're in Dahlonega and you feel like going for a drive, make sure you head down to Northeast George History Center. Explore the museum on your own, or join one of the tours. The museum offers plenty of interactive exhibits where you can learn a little about the cultural history of the area. They offer free admission on Family Days, and the museum is a fantastic place to bring the kids for an outing. There are also free digital programs available. If you're in the Dahlonega area, there are plenty of great museums to check out. Make sure you visit all four of these to learn all about the area's history.
